<< Trinitrons are 100% vertically flat but not horizontally

horizontally they have a slight curve to them, but its only slight. Typically the glass on the front has been shaped flat both horizontally and vertically, but the inside of the front glass with the pixels has a curve to it horizontally. Since the outside is 100% flat it does look a bit better because the glare isnt as bad.

Now sonys Vega series tv's, they're 100% flat in every aspect. Although I dont know if they're going to use the same technology for pc monitors. They might not bother considering the initial cost of development, and that LCD monitors are really the future of mainstream systems so the life of vega pc monitors would be short.

I purchased the sun equivelant of this monitor for 200 off ebay. I'd probably consider myself lucky, cause it was brand new and the guy lived ~20 miles from me, but it's still worth looking at if you can't get in on the dell deal

the sun model # is CPD-4410
EXCELLENT monitor for those of you that do decide to get it. I'm running 1600x1200 @ 85hz with perfect visible geometry, no bleeding, and no visible moire!

YMMV on ebay as always, but it's worth looking... but I'd recommend only buying in your area as shipping can be a bit much, and the AG wires are easily misaligned in shipping.
